^ Similarly, wpt, if you re-watch the first quarter, you will see Gawn deep in defence, helping out May and Lever, whilst Grundy is up at wing half-forward, pressing the ball back in, time after time, for repeat forward 50 entries. The weight of numbers tells. Before Melbourne can actually get the ball out of defence in the first quarter, the game should be over - and but for a couple of uncharacteristic misses from Stevo (the first after a mark 35 metres out, DIF within 9 seconds of the first bounce), it would have been.

Top 3 all-time career hitout tallies for players who played at least partly for Collingwood:

Grundy 5,443 (171 games)
Jolly 4,968 (237 games)
Thompson 4,642 (301 games)

20 highest hitout tallies in a game by a Collingwood player - since 1965:

Brodie Grundy 73 2019 v GW
Brodie Grundy 64 2019 v SY
Brodie Grundy 58 2019 v WB
Brodie Grundy 57 2018 v SY
Brodie Grundy 56 2018 v RI
Brodie Grundy 54 2021 v BL
Brodie Grundy 53 2017 v ME
Brodie Grundy 51 2021 v CA
Brodie Grundy 50 2019 v WB
Darren Jolly 49 2012 v HW
Brodie Grundy 49 2018 v GC
Brodie Grundy 49 2018 v WC
Brodie Grundy 49 2019 v SK
Brodie Grundy 48 2018 v FR
Brodie Grundy 48 2019 v CA
Brodie Grundy 48 2019 v GW
Brodie Grundy 48 2018 v WC
Brodie Grundy 48 2018 v RI
Brodie Grundy 47 2019 v GE
Brodie Grundy 47 2016 v WB

Top 20 season hitout totals for Collingwood since 1965:

Brodie Grundy 1038 2018
Brodie Grundy 1022 2019
Brodie Grundy 714 2017
Darren Jolly 649 2012
Brodie Grundy 647 2021
Brodie Grundy 593 2020
Peter Moore 580 1980
Darren Jolly 579 2010
Peter Moore 579 1981
Brodie Grundy 548 2016
Len Thompson 505 1968
Peter Moore 495 1979
Len Thompson 474 1972
Brodie Grundy 462 2015
Len Thompson 458 1967
Len Thompson 457 1973
Graeme Jenkin 456 1971
Len Thompson 441 1966
Len Thompson 411 1977
Darren Jolly 383 2011

Thanks for these incredible stats- Interesting to note that Peter Moore (1979) and Len Thompson (1972) each had less than 500 hitouts and yet each won the Brownlow Medal in that year.

In 1971, Bobby Rose played 'Jerka' Jenkin in ruck and Thommo was played mostly as a half forward. The following year, Neil Mann took over and played Thommo in the ruck where 'Big Len' dominated with his deft ruck work giving Barry Price and the Richardson brothers an armchair ride.
1972 was the last year that McKenna topped 100 goals for the Pies (an amazing 130 goals- 53 points for the season...)
